Latest Patents
Madhavan's latest patents include groundbreaking methods for facilitating customer-initiated interactions with contact centers. One notable patent describes a system that allows customers to send images of a target object to a contact center. This method processes the images to identify the object, retrieve relevant information, and determine a problem statement for effective resolution. Another patent focuses on call mobility, enabling seamless transitions between devices during active calls, ensuring that customers remain connected to the same agent throughout their interactions.
